Output 05e861ca7429872c6a49156e0d50bc05f0e616e3e943b8ba96f58cc76803b91c:3

value
4028983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ecab03e74f0f4d801ccd6bcec8d008b00f7e5417 OP_EQUAL
address
3PGQGASExvg6P7NBy2vceDLwTGj2Lgj5QK
transaction
05e861ca7429872c6a49156e0d50bc05f0e616e3e943b8ba96f58cc76803b91c
spent
true